Cuban Tiles in Colonial-Era Remodel
Cuban Tiles in Colonial-Era Remodel
Avente TileAvente Tile
A Cuban cement tile backsplash is a popular choice for a kitchen backsplash, wall or wainscot because the tiles add color, pattern, and the appearance of texture or movement. See how one of our customers, Donna Hochberg, used these tiles in a remodel of her Colonial-era home. What you'll notice is how versatile these tiles are and how great they look with the rustic finishes in the home. A Cuban cement tile backsplash was a great choice because it allowed her to customize the colors while creating a unique look that feels right at home. All photos by Cydney Scott.

Begg kitchen
Begg kitchen
Upper Canada CastrcreteUpper Canada Castrcrete
This kitchen project consisted of a large 10'6" x 4'6" island with an integral drainboard emulating rolling waves inspired by the view over Stoney Lake. Matching counters and backsplashes complement the distressed cabinets.
